Abstract
A conductive composition is disclosed. The conductive composition comprises a thermochromic material and a conductive material dispersed in a resin. An electrical system is also disclosed which incorporates the conductive composition in combination with a power source.

14. An electrical system comprising:
- a substrate;
conductive composition arranged on said substrate, said conductive composition including a thermochromic material and a conductive material dispersed in a resin, said thermochromic material comprises an ambient color and at least a second color, said thermochromic material being present in an amount of between 2%-75% by weight so that said ambient color changes to said second color in response to a sufficient amount of heat applied thereto; and
a power source connected to said conductive composition whereby current can flow from said power source through said conductive composition. - View Dependent Claims (15, 16, 17, 18)
